Salaperäinen Saari: Seikkailukertomus, first published in 1875 by Jules Verne, follows a group of castaways who survive a balloon crash during the American Civil War and find themselves on an uncharted island in the Pacific. Led by engineer Cyrus Smith, they face survival challenges and uncover the island's mysteries, aided by a mysterious power. This novel is notable for its blend of adventure and science fiction, and it connects with themes and characters from Verne's earlier works, such as Twenty Thousand Leagues Under the Sea.
